01 - Preheat oven to 350°F. Line two baking sheets with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
02 - In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, salt, cardamom, and cinnamon until well blended. Set aside.
03 - In a large bowl, beat soft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ar together until light and fluffy, approximately 2-3 minutes.
04 - Beat in eggs one at a time, ensuring each is fully incorporated before adding the next. Stir in vanilla extract.
05 - Gradually mix the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, stirring until just combined. Avoid overmixing to maintain chewy texture.
06 - Gently fold chopped dates, pistachios, and chocolate chips if using into the dough until evenly distributed.
07 - Scoop tablespoon-sized balls of dough onto prepared baking sheets, spacing approximately 2 inches apart to allow for spreading.
08 - Bake for 10-12 minutes until edges turn golden brown while centers remain slightly soft for optimal chewiness.
09 - Let cookies rest on baking sheets for 5 minutes to set, then transfer to wire rack to cool completely before serving.
